Product Overview

Category

The 1N4002-N-2-3-AP belongs to the category of rectifier diodes.

Use

It is commonly used in electronic circuits for converting alternating current (AC) to direct current (DC).

Characteristics

  • Forward Voltage Drop: 0.93V
  • Reverse Voltage: 100V
  • Average Rectified Current: 1A
  • Maximum Surge Current: 30A
  • Operating Temperature Range: -65°C to +175°C

Package

The 1N4002-N-2-3-AP is typically available in a DO-41 package.

Detailed Pin Configuration

The 1N4002-N-2-3-AP has two pins: 1. Anode (A) 2. Cathode (K)

Disadvantages

  • Limited maximum forward current compared to higher-rated diodes.
  • Higher forward voltage drop compared to Schottky diodes.

Working Principles

The 1N4002-N-2-3-AP operates based on the principle of semiconductor junction behavior, allowing current flow in one direction while blocking it in the reverse direction.

  7. Is 1N4002-N-2-3-AP suitable for use in high-frequency applications?

    • No, 1N4002-N-2-3-AP is not suitable for high-frequency applications due to its relatively slow recovery time.
